Microsoft hesabıyla oturum açın
Oturum açın veya hesap oluşturun.
Merhaba,
Farklı bir hesap seçin.
Birden çok hesabınız var
Oturum açmak istediğiniz hesabı seçin.

Not:  En güncel yardım içeriklerini, mümkün olduğunca hızlı biçimde kendi dilinizde size sunmak için çalışıyoruz. Bu sayfanın çevirisi otomasyon aracılığıyla yapılmıştır ve bu nedenle hatalı veya yanlış dil bilgisi kullanımları içerebilir. Amacımız, bu içeriğin sizin için faydalı olabilmesini sağlamaktır. Buradaki bilgilerin faydalı olup olmadığını bu sayfanın sonunda bize bildirebilir misiniz? Kolayca başvurabilmek için İngilizce makaleye buradan ulaşabilirsiniz .

Microsoft Office InfoPath 2007 form şablonunu tasarlarken, form şablonunda alanlara bağlı denetimler için varsayılan değerleri atayabilirsiniz. Kullanıcı form doldurmaya açıldığında otomatik olarak bir denetimde görüntülenen değeri bir varsayılan değerdir.

Bu makalede

Varsayılan değerleri genel bakış

Bir form şablonu tasarladığınızda, formunuzu daha hızlı doldurma kullanıcılara yardım etmek için denetimler için varsayılan değerleri atayabilirsiniz. Örneğin, bir çalışan gider raporu form şablonu oluşturursanız, tarih seçici denetimi için varsayılan değer olarak bugünün tarihi atayabilirsiniz. Sonuç olarak, geçerli tarihi otomatik olarak tarih seçme denetiminde kullanıcı form açar ve tarih el ile girmek zorunda değildir doldurulur.

Form şablonunuzda, varsayılan değerleri ayarlayabilirsiniz:

  • Kullanıcı form doldurmaya açıldığında otomatik olarak doldurulan bir denetim için belirli bir değer atama.

  • Bir denetim için varsayılan değer ayarlamak için kural kullanarak, başka bir form denetimindeki kullanıcı girer verilere bağlı.

  • Bir kerede tüm form şablonunuz için varsayılan değerleri ayarlama.

Sayfanın Başı

Bir denetim için varsayılan değerini ayarlama

Form şablonunuzda bir alan için varsayılan değer ayarladığınızda, kullanıcı bu form şablonunu temel alan bir formu doldururken, görünmesi gereken değer otomatik olarak denetimde belirtirsiniz.

  1. Veri kaynağı görev bölmesi görünmüyorsa, Görünüm menüsünde Veri kaynağı ' ı tıklatın.

  2. Veri kaynağı görev bölmesinde, varsayılan değer ayarlamak istediğiniz alanı sağ tıklatın ve kısayol menüsünde Özellikler ' i tıklatın.

  3. Veri sekmesine tıklayın.

  4. Aşağıdakilerden birini yapın:

    • Belirli bir değeri varsayılan değer olarak kullanmak için varsayılan değer değer kutusuna yazın.

    • Varsayılan değeri oluşturmak için XPath ifadesi kullanmak için Formül Ekle Düğme resmitıklatın ve sonra Formül Ekle iletişim kutusunda, XPath ifadesi oluşturun.

      İpucu: Formül her hesaplandığında seçili alanındaki değer otomatik olarak güncelleştirmek için alan veya Grup Özellikleri iletişim kutusunda formülün sonucu hesaplandığında bu değeri güncelleştir onay kutusunu seçin.

  5. Yaptığınız değişiklikleri test etmek için, Standart araç çubuğunda Önizleme’ye tıklayın veya CTRL+SHIFT+B tuşlarına basın.

Teknik ayrıntıları

Bir denetim için varsayılan değer ayarladığınızda, ayrıca alanı için varsayılan değer olduğu denetimin bağlı olduğu ayarlamakta olduğunuz. O alana bağlı herhangi bir denetimi aynı varsayılan değeri atanır.

Varsayılan değeri belirtilen bir değerse, bu değer form şablonu ile ilişkili template.xml dosyasını depolanır. Varsayılan değer programatik olarak değiştirmek için uygun alanı template.xml dosyasında değerini değiştirin. Varsayılan değer XPath ifadenin sonucunu ise, ifade manifest.xsf dosyasında, alan için xsf:calculatedField öğesinde depolanır.

Sayfanın Başı

Bir kuralı kullanarak varsayılan değerini ayarlama

Başka bir denetimin değerine dayalı bir denetimin varsayılan değeri ayarlamak için bir kural kullanabilirsiniz. Bir kural formdaki bir koşul karşılandığında oluşan bir eylemdir. Örneğin, bir durum ve başka bir denetimi için ZIP kodu içeren bir form şablonu tasarlama. Bir kullanıcı bir posta kodu posta kodu denetimde girdiğinde, eyalet denetimi doğru durumu ile otomatik olarak doldurulur.

Bu yordamı tamamlamak için iki denetimleri form şablonunuzda olması gerekir; kullanıcı uygulamasına veri girer ve varsayılan bir değerle doldurulur temelinde ilk denetime girilen verileri.

  1. Varsayılan değer olan denetim dayalı denetimi çift tıklatın.

    Örneğin, eyalet ve posta kodu denetimleri olması durumunda, posta kodu denetim çift.

  2. Veri sekmesine tıklayın.

  3. Doğrulama ve kurallarıaltında kurallar' ı tıklatın.

  4. Kurallar iletişim kutusunda, Ekle'yitıklatın.

  5. Ad kutusuna kural için bir ad yazın.

  6. Kuralın çalışmasını belirtmek için Koşul Ayarla'yıtıklatın.

  7. Koşul iletişim kutusunda, koşulu girin ve Tamam' ı tıklatın.

    Kullanıcı ilk kutusundaki başka bir denetime veri girdiğinde denetime eklenmesi için kullanıcı uygulamasına veri girer alanı tıklatın, bir varsayılan değer isterseniz, örneğin, eşittir ikinci kutuda ve son kutusunda seçeneğini tıklatın , kullanıcının denetime girmesi verileri girin.

  8. Kuralı iletişim kutusunda, Eylem Ekle'ıtıklatın.

  9. Eylem listesinde, bir alanın değerini ayarla' yı tıklatın.

  10. Alan kutusunun yanındaki Düğme görüntüsütıklatın ve sonra bir alan veya Grup Seç iletişim kutusunda, varsayılan değer ayarlamak istediğiniz denetimi tıklatın.

  11. Aşağıdakilerden birini yapın:

    • Varsayılan değer olarak belirtilen bir değere kullanmak için değer kutusuna değeri yazın ve Tamam' ı tıklatın.

    • Varsayılan değeri oluşturmak için XPath ifadesi kullanmak için Formül Ekle Düğme resmitıklayın, Formül Ekle iletişim kutusunda formülü girin ve Tamam' ı tıklatın.

  12. Yaptığınız değişiklikleri test etmek için, Standart araç çubuğunda Önizleme’ye tıklayın veya CTRL+SHIFT+B tuşlarına basın.

Sayfanın Başı

Tüm form için varsayılan değerleri ayarlama

Tüm denetimleri, varsayılan değer olur ve varsayılan değerleri kurallarında esaslı olmayan form şablonunuzdaki biliyorsanız, tüm varsayılan değerleri aynı anda ayarlayabilirsiniz.

  1. Araçlar menüsünde, Form Seçenekleri' ni tıklatın.

  2. Kategori listesinde, Gelişmiş ' i tıklatın ve ardından Varsayılan değerleri Düzenle'yitıklatın.

  3. Varsayılan değerleri Düzenle iletişim kutusunda, varsayılan değer ayarlamak istediğiniz alanı seçin.

  4. Aşağıdakilerden birini yapın:

    • Varsayılan değer olarak belirtilen bir değere kullanmak için alanın varsayılan değeri Varsayılan değer kutusuna yazın ve Tamam' ı tıklatın.

    • Varsayılan değeri oluşturmak için XPath ifadesi kullanmak için Formül Ekle Düğme resmitıklatın ve sonra Formül Ekle iletişim kutusunda, XPath ifadesi oluşturun.

      İpucu: Formül her hesaplandığında seçili alanındaki değer otomatik olarak güncelleştirmek için Varsayılan değerleri Düzenle iletişim kutusunda formülün sonucu hesaplandığında bu değeri güncelleştir onay kutusunu seçin.

  5. Adım 3 ve 4 adım varsayılan değeri ayarlamak istediğiniz her alan için yineleyin.

  6. Yaptığınız değişiklikleri test etmek için, Standart araç çubuğunda Önizleme’ye tıklayın veya CTRL+SHIFT+B tuşlarına basın.

Sayfanın Başı

Daha fazla yardıma mı ihtiyacınız var?

Daha fazla seçenek mi istiyorsunuz?

Abonelik avantajlarını keşfedin, eğitim kurslarına göz atın, cihazınızın güvenliğini nasıl sağlayacağınızı öğrenin ve daha fazlasını yapın.

Topluluklar, soru sormanıza ve soruları yanıtlamanıza, geri bildirimde bulunmanıza ve zengin bilgiye sahip uzmanlardan bilgi almanıza yardımcı olur.

Bu bilgi yararlı oldu mu?

Dil kalitesinden ne kadar memnunsunuz?
Deneyiminizi ne etkiledi?
Gönder’e bastığınızda, geri bildiriminiz Microsoft ürün ve hizmetlerini geliştirmek için kullanılır. BT yöneticiniz bu verileri toplayabilecek. Gizlilik Bildirimi.

Geri bildiriminiz için teşekkürler!

×